Shortly after this clip was taken, the second works DAF Turbotwin truck, driven by Theo van de Rijt, with Kees van Loevezijn and Chris Ross as engineer/copilot, somersaulted at 180 kph after hitting a dune. Van Loevezijn was ejected off the truck and died at the scene, while Ross and van de Rijt were badly injured. It is after this tragedy that DAF pulled out of rally raid, scrapped its works team and sold its assets to the de Rooy family for Jan and Gerard de Rooy to enter again as privateers at their own wish. Jan had won the Dakar once and Gerard would later do so twice.

@@tigervv6437 True, but a huge truck has far worse aerodynamics and the faster you go the worse it's going to get. The weight also is factor since it's going to sink down in the loose sand a lot more and thus obviously have much more mechanical friction. According to DAF's own webpage their 1988 Dakar truck weighed 10500 kilos - that's 10,5 tons! The Peugeot 405 T16 Dakar was merely 900 kilos dry (heavier fully loaded) which isn't even a ton. That means the truck was roughly 10 times as heavy! Even with 1200hp you think that is not going to be enough against a far more nimble and aerodynamically sleek rally car.
